Amitosis

  • Direct cell division
  • By Remak & explained by Flemming
  • No chr. differentiation & spindle
  • Nuclei elongate, constrict & forms two daughter cells
  • Common in diseased cells
  • E. g. , Monera
  • Others are indirect cell division

Cell Division Plant Mitosis and Animal Mitosis Table - 1
Plant MitosisAnimal Mitosis
In meristemIn many places
By cytokininBy lymphokines, epidermal growth factors
No change in shapeBecomes spherical
Spindle – An astralSpindle - Amphiastral
Centriole is absentSpindle pole possess centriole
Equatorial region forms phragmoplastEquatorial region forms midbody
Cytokinesis by cell plateBy cleavage
Cell plate grow centrifugallyGrows centripetally
Microfilament not importantImportant role
Cell plate cements daughter cellsCleavage creates intracellular space between daughter cells

Significance of Mitosis

  • Growth
  • Maintenance of surface-volume ratio
  • Maintenance of chromosome number
  • Regeneration
  • Reproduction and repair
  • Differentiation
  • Cancer – uncontrolled mitotic division
